The IW Arts Society’s new season will be kicked off by a visit from Marc Allum, famous from his many appearances on the BBC’s Antiques Roadshow. He has been a miscellaneous specialist on the BBC Antiques Roadshow since 1998 and has appeared on numerous television and radio programmes. Marc regularly writes for mainstream magazines and is an author, antiques consultant and lecturer.

Marc has his own unique style with interests ranging from pre-history to modern design and is a self-confessed collectaholic. He has a passion and reputation for divining the unusual; 'a desire to connect with history through the interpretation and pursuit of objects and their origins'.

Marc will take members and visitors on a behind the scenes look at the UK's most beloved Antiques show and talk about some of the most intriguing, enigmatic and valuable finds over the last few decades.
